Cardigans are a forever staple in autumn capsule wardrobes for a reason, as they offer an effortless yet classic look no matter how you style them. And, of course, they win points for practicality and versatility, too. Always on hand to offer an extra layer of warmth, they’re just as easily thrown on over casual autumn outfit ideas as they are with office-ready smart casual outfits – and they can even be updated to work alongside more evening-appropriate attire, too.

With a bold, striped knit like Lorraine’s, there’s plenty of styling options. You can keep it simple with your most comfortable jeans and some cosy boots for everyday, or for occasions, a leather skirt or tailored trousers can offer a sleek contrast with textured knits.

For a cohesive feel, pick out the tones in whichever knit you choose to wear and highlight them with your choice of skirt, jeans or trousers; just as Lorraine pulled out the burgundy stripes of her cardi with her choice of skirt. Finishing off a look like this with some pumps or loafers makes light work of elevated autumn styling.
